And my IA to CA Endorsement experience goes a lil something like this...4/22- mailed my application, fingerprint cards, requested transcripts from 5 schools to be sent, registered for Nursys...all done with USPS
tracking (verifies all delivery by 4/28).
5/14- personal check cashed and Breeze shows submission date of 5/8, shows open "missing educ history" and one of my colleges in suspense.
5/28- spoke to BRN states my fingerprint card was accepted.
6/5- following this forum starting to get worried because I didnt apply for temporary license and Im scheduled to start work 8-3. spoke to BRN, was told not to apply for it wouldnt make a difference.
6/23- spoke to very nice person at BRN, stated that I should apply for temporary license due to them being far behind. I sent my request and personal check that same day.
6/29- Breeze notes and deficiencies cleared, shows open
7/8- personal check clears for temporary license request
7/9- spoke to BRN states my file is complete all except my transcript information and she doesnt understand why my temporary license has not been submitted. She thought it would be a good idea to resend all my transcripts since it had been almost 11 weeks. I was put on a call back list that could take up to 10-15 days. I was not very happy with this information. I didnt want to file a complaint because I understand they are busy and behind. But the fact that my transcripts are assumed to be lost and I should just resend them for fun, I had just had enough. I submitted my complaint.
7/10- my temporary license appeared on Breeze!! Im not sure if this was just a coincidence or if my complaint is being investigated. Either way I am happy and ready to start my dream job! Im still going to stay on top of things January (expiration date) is just around the corner!

I had no issues with receiving a temp license.
My application was delivered by mail to the PO box address on August 12th. My check was cashed exactly 3 weeks later on September 2nd. My date on breeze was August 28th. My temporary license was issued on October 2nd - 5 weeks from my breeze date. Very surprised after reading all the trouble most people have with the process, and considering the timeline the board has on their website.
I used paper prints and nursys verifcation.

Also, can you use Breeze to track a licensure by endorsement? There doesn't seem to be that option :/
Yes you can. But you won't be able to track a license until you're payment is processed. When it is processed you will create an account and add a license. Once you add your license type, it will show up.
